Finding Peace in San Jose: A Journey Back Home

Dionne Warwick's song "Do You Know The Way To San Jose" is a poignant exploration of the disillusionment that often accompanies the pursuit of fame and fortune. The lyrics tell the story of someone who has been away from their hometown for a long time, seeking success in the bustling city of Los Angeles. However, the protagonist finds that the promises of stardom and wealth are often empty, leading to a sense of loss and longing for the simplicity and familiarity of home.

The song contrasts the chaotic, fast-paced life of Los Angeles with the serene, spacious environment of San Jose. Los Angeles is depicted as a place where dreams can quickly turn into disillusionment, with many aspiring stars ending up in menial jobs, such as parking cars and pumping gas. This imagery highlights the harsh reality that not everyone achieves their dreams, and the pursuit of fame can often lead to a sense of emptiness and isolation.

In contrast, San Jose represents a place of comfort, peace, and genuine connections. The protagonist longs to return to San Jose, where they have friends and can find peace of mind. This longing for home and the desire to escape the superficiality of the entertainment industry is a central theme of the song. It speaks to the universal human experience of seeking a place where one truly belongs and can find solace amidst life's challenges.

The song's message is timeless, resonating with anyone who has ever felt the pull of ambition only to realize that true happiness often lies in the simple, familiar places we call home. Dionne Warwick's soulful delivery adds depth to the lyrics, making the listener feel the protagonist's yearning and ultimate realization that home is where the heart finds peace.
